Output a75dd45acb439cc7ca824cbb39f25f43953f6972ae875c8a6d1af4d41422b925:3

value
107487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03efc63626c3a7f4021d621d5473e10b829517b9 OP_EQUAL
address
323qBvjDVDAg1J3L4mk6Tc6mjzU7uvTXor
transaction
a75dd45acb439cc7ca824cbb39f25f43953f6972ae875c8a6d1af4d41422b925
confirmations
35130
spent
true